HYDRAULIC BRAKE FLUID DEFINITION HYDRAULIC BRAKE FLUID is a high performance polyglycol brake fluid formulated to reduce the absorption of water and therefore minimise brake fade. HYDRAULIC BRAKE FLUID has a high boiling point and low volatility, excellent chemical and oxidation stability, controlled rubber swell and lubrication of seals and is non-corrosive to brake line components. PROPERTIES Grade ISO 4925 Grade SAE J1703 Specifications Meets or Exceeds US FMVSS 116 DOT 3 and DOT 4 GMH HN 1796 Ford ESW FM6C-2 Aust. Stand.1960-1983 Grade 3 Boiling Point deg. C (min. dry) 280 Boiling Point deg. C (min. wet) 180
APPLICATIONS
HYDRAULIC BRAKE FLUID can be used for disc or drum brake and clutch systems in passenger and commercial vehicles used under hard driving conditions.
Avoid spilling on paintwork and do not use where mineral oils are specified.
